Abstract (EN)

SUMMARYObjective: Relation of chronic kidney disease (CKD) and ACE I/D genepolymorphism and the effect of that relation in patient population is a subjectwhich has plenty of studies on it last years. We aim to study on that relation withthe patients are treated with dialysis in our dialysis center.Material and methods: 87 patients and 38 normal people were studied. Bloodpressure, body mass index (BMI) and biochemical parameters were checked inthese people. Blood pressure were measured as determined in JCN 7 reportand over 140 mmHg systolic blood pressure and/or over 90 mmHg diastolicblood pressure accepted as hypertension. In genotyping ACE I/Dpolymorphism was studied by using polymerase chain reaction.Results: 49 (%56.3) people were in HD and 38 (%43.7) people were in SAPDprogram. 38 people were in control group. In the control group we chose peopleand their first degree relatives who don?t have Diabetes Mellitus, chronic kidneydisease, hypertension and ischemic heart disease.Age, sex, BMI, systolic and diastolic blood pressures of patients and the controlgroup were compared. The patient group?s average age was 41.1±13.6 years,and the control group?s average age was 38.0±1.41 years (p= 0.162). The ratioof female/male in the patient group was 39/48, in the control group was 24/14(p=0.059). The patient group?s BMI was 22.1±4.2 kg/m2, and the controlgroup?s BMI was 23.4±2.4 kg/ m2 (p=0.065). In the patient group systolic bloodpressure was measured 136.5±18.4 mmHg, and in the control group wasmeasured 116.3±14.4 mmHg. In the patient group diastolic blood pressure wasmeasured 81.3±8.6 mmHg and in control group was measured 69.2±10.2mmHg. The patient group?s systolic blood pressure (p=0.001) and diastolicblood pressure (p=0.001) was significantly higher than control group (p=0.001).The etiological reasons of ESRD in patient group were 24 (%28) DM , 21(%24) HT, 19 (%23) chronic glomerulonephritis, 8 (%9) postrenal kidneydisease, 4 (%5) polycystic kidney disease, 11 (%11) with unknown etiologykidney insufficiency .In the patient group ACE gene (I/D) polymorphism prevalence was found I/I 8(%0.9), I/D 39 (44.8), D/D 40 (%45.9) and in the control group was found I/I1112(%31.5) , I/D 15 (39.4), D/D 11 (%28.9) and statically differences were seen(p=0.006). The distribution of ACE D alleles were compared in the patient andcontrol groups. In the patient group was %68.4 and in the control group was%48.7 (p=0,001). D allele was dominant. Patient group was compared for thedistribution of ACE gene allele etiologically. In diabetes mellitus, hypertension,chronic glomerulonephritis and postrenal kidney disease D allele was dominant.Conclusion: In the patient group for the ACE gene polymorphism, on the Dallele frequency and genotype distribution, D/D dominancy was seen. D alleledistribution was significantly dominant in diabetes mellitus, hypertension,chronic glomerulonephritis and postrenal kidney disease. The present dataindicate that chronic kidney disease may associate with ACE I/D genepolymorphism and that association may effect the renal disease progression.Key Words: Angiotensin converting enzyme, ACE I/D polymorphism, ESRD12
